Abstract

The utility model relates to an electric energy conversion device, in particular to an integral conversion circuit based on atmospheric composition detection, which comprises a capacitor circuit, a high-precision voltage reference source and a high-precision analog-to-digital converter. In the capacitor circuit, an integrator receives a current signal of the high-voltage electrode, carries out integration processing and stores charges, and two ends of a capacitor are connected with the high-voltage electrode and a feedback path of the amplifier; the high-precision voltage reference source provides a reference voltage, the amplifier increases the voltage of an input signal and generates an output voltage, the voltage reference compares the reference voltage with the output voltage, and the feedback network adjusts the output voltage according to a comparison result; the high-precision analog-to-digital converter converts voltage signals at the two ends of the integrating capacitor into digital signals and outputs the digital signals. The integration precision and stability of weak current are improved, and the sensor can detect the concentration of volatile organic compounds more accurately and reliably.

Technical Field

[0001] The utility model relates to the technical field of integrated circuits, in particular to an integral conversion circuit based on atmospheric component detection. Background Art

[0002] Air pollution monitoring refers to the process of observing the main pollutants in a region's atmosphere and evaluating the quality of the atmospheric environment. Air quality monitoring typically involves regularly monitoring a specified area using a few or a dozen representative sampling points, based on factors such as the region's size, the distribution of air pollution sources, meteorological conditions, and topography.

[0003] An integrator circuit makes its output signal proportional to the time-integrated value of its input signal. It is primarily used in waveform transformation, eliminating offset voltage in amplifier circuits, and performing integral compensation in feedback control. The integrator circuit is a widely used analog signal processing circuit. It is the basic unit of analog computers, used to simulate differential equations. It is also a crucial element commonly used in control and measurement systems, leveraging its charge and discharge processes to achieve time delay, timing, and various waveform generation. The integrator circuit outputs the integral of the input signal over a frequency range based on the circuit's time constant and the amplifier's bandwidth. An input signal is applied to the inverting input to invert the output relative to the input signal's extremes.

[0004] The DDC112 is a current-input A / D converter chip manufactured by Texas Instruments. It features a wide input range, high resolution (up to 20 bits), and a fast sampling speed (1.5 kHz), meeting the requirements of near-infrared spectroscopy data acquisition. The DDC112 primarily relies on capacitor integration to acquire the input current signal. When the DDC112 is operating, the integrating capacitor first charges VREF. As the DDC112 and the capacitor continue to integrate, the input current signal releases the capacitor's charge, causing the output voltage of the operational amplifier to decrease. When integration is complete, the input signal switches to the other terminal, where the internal voltage-input ADC measures the held value of VREF. This process repeats continuously and efficiently, continuously integrating the input signal and completing the A / D conversion of the current signal.

[0005] For example, the Chinese invention patent with announcement number CN114189246A discloses a current-voltage conversion circuit and method, an integrator, and an analog-to-digital converter. A current scaling control unit is configured between the input circuit unit and the output circuit unit of the current-voltage conversion circuit. The current scaling control unit can adaptively scale the input current according to the set current gear to obtain an intermediate current that meets the set current range. The output circuit unit converts the intermediate current into an output voltage signal. The current scaling control unit includes a preamplifier and a multi-stage current mirror branch. The multi-stage current mirror branch is configured with outputs of multiple current gears and can select a set current gear from the multiple current gears as needed. Thus, the input current is adaptively scaled by setting the number and width of the multi-stage current mirror branches. For a large current range from small current to large current, it is possible to obtain a reasonable output voltage while ensuring the high bandwidth performance of the current-voltage conversion circuit.

[0006] Conventional integration circuits currently suffer from low detection accuracy and poor stability for extremely small currents. To address these issues, this utility model proposes an integration and conversion circuit based on atmospheric composition detection. The circuit receives a weak current signal from a high-voltage electrode, integrates it through a capacitor, and then calibrates and stabilizes the integrated voltage signal using a high-precision voltage reference source. The signal is then converted to digital using a high-precision ADC, ultimately outputting a digitized current value. Utility Model Content

[0051] Example 1

[0052] like Figure 1 As shown, an integral conversion circuit based on atmospheric component detection includes a capacitor circuit and a high-precision analog-to-digital converter;

[0053] In the capacitor circuit, the integrator receives the weak current signal of the high-voltage electrode, performs integration processing and stores charge, and the two ends of the capacitor are connected to the high-voltage electrode and the feedback path of the amplifier;

[0054] The high-precision analog-to-digital converter converts the voltage signal across the integrating capacitor into a digital signal, which is then output to the MCU for digital signal processing and analysis, and outputs a digitized current.

[0055] like Figure 3 As shown, the working principle of the capacitor circuit is:

[0056] 1. The sampling switch is closed, the output enable is disconnected (to prevent the back-end sampling from absorbing charge and affecting the accuracy), and the charge flows into the integration capacitor through the path.

[0057] 2. After the charge is injected into the capacitor, the voltage value on the integrating capacitor will change.

[0058] 3. After the voltage on the capacitor changes, due to the "virtual short" effect of the op amp, in order to maintain the voltage at the negative input and positive input of the op amp the same (here is 0V), the output of the op amp will output a voltage value, which is equal to the voltage value on the capacitor and has opposite polarity.

[0059] 4. Current is continuously injected during the sampling period (integration time). The integrating capacitor is continuously injected during the sampling period (integration time). Given the integration time and the capacitance of the capacitor, the current can be calculated by calculating the amount of charge injected per unit time. After the sampling period ends, the sampling enable is disconnected, the clock input enable is enabled, and the voltage on the capacitor begins to be collected.

[0060] 5. At the end of a sampling cycle, the sampling enable switch is turned off and the integration reset switch is closed to release the charge in the capacitor and prepare for the next integration.

[0061] 6. Disconnect the reset switch, close the sampling enable switch, and continue charging for the next cycle.

[0081] Voltage Reference (U3) Stability: The voltage reference (U3) is the heart of the circuit, providing a stable reference voltage (typically with an extremely low temperature coefficient and high accuracy). IN (1) is the input, OUT (2) is the output, and GND (3) is the ground. Through complex internal circuit design and precise calibration, U3 is able to output an extremely stable voltage value that serves as the reference for the entire circuit.

[0082] Filtering and decoupling: Capacitor C11 is connected between the 5V voltage source and the IN (1) terminal of the voltage reference, acting as a filter, reducing the impact of high-frequency noise from the power supply on the voltage reference and improving the purity of the input signal. C12 and C13 are connected in parallel between the OUT (2) terminal of the voltage reference and ground, and the other end of C13 is connected to the non-inverting input terminal of the amplifier, providing decoupling for the output of the voltage reference, reducing the impact of power supply fluctuations on the output voltage, and also enhancing the filtering effect through the parallel capacitor, further improving the voltage stability. The amplifier (U2) adopts a negative feedback configuration (the inverting input terminal is connected to the OUT terminal), which greatly improves the stability and linearity of the amplifier. Negative feedback causes the output voltage of the amplifier to tend to a stable value, that is, the voltage received by its non-inverting input terminal (coupled through C13 and the voltage reference OUT (2)). In this way, even if there are slight fluctuations in the input signal or power supply, the amplifier can quickly adjust its output to maintain the stability and accuracy of the output voltage. C14 is connected between the OUT terminal of the amplifier and the ground, which further filters out the high-frequency noise at the output of the amplifier and ensures the high accuracy and stability of the final output voltage.

[0089] The TXS0108EPWR is an 8-bit non-inverting translator with two independent, configurable power rails. The A port is designed to track VCCA, which accepts a 1.2 to 3.6V supply voltage; the B port is designed to track VCCB, which accepts a 1.65 to 5.5V supply voltage. This allows low-voltage bidirectional translation between any 1.2, 1.5, 1.8, 2.5, 3.3, and 5V voltage nodes. When the output enable (OE) input is LOW, all outputs are placed in a high-impedance state. To ensure the high-impedance state during power-up or power-down, OE should be connected to GND through a pull-down resistor. The minimum resistor value is determined by the current-sourcing capability of the driver.

[0112] like Figure 9As shown, the charge / current conversion formula is:

[0113] 1. According to capacitor voltage = charge / capacitance, where the voltage is measured through the circuit and the capacitance is known, the charge can be calculated.

[0114] 2. Current = charge / charging time.
